OFFICIAL LEGAL TITLE
Biomass for Transportation Fuel Act
F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TIONS
What is the official ID of this bill?
The official print number for this legislation is 118_HR_7609.
Which chamber initiated this legislation?
This legislation was initiated in the House of Representatives.
When did the legislative process begin?
The process officially started on 2024-03-11.
What are the main provisions?
Key points include:
- Establishes a credit system (eRINs) for electricity derived from biomass used to power transportation, supporting cleaner energy sources.
- Broadens the legal definition of renewable biomass to include more types of trees and residue from forestlands, including tribal lands.
- Requires the EPA to speed up the approval process for new biomass energy projects and publicly disclose review timelines.

Who is the primary sponsor?
The primary sponsor is Rep. Garamendi, John [D-CA-8].
What is the latest detailed status?
The latest detailed status is: Referred to the Subcommittee on Environment, Manufacturing, and Critical Materials.
